Annika Sörenstam

Professional golfer and course designer
Born
October 9th, 1970 54 years ago

A professional golfer and golf course designer, achieved significant success in women's golf throughout the late 1990s and early 2000s. Won 10 major championships, placing her among the most successful female golfers of all time. Competed on the LPGA Tour, earning 72 victories and gaining recognition for exceptional skill and dedication to the sport. Transitioned to a role in golf course design after retiring from competitive play, contributing to the development of golf facilities worldwide.

Kenny Anderson

Basketball player and coach
Born
October 9th, 1970 54 years ago

Played college basketball at Georgia Tech before being selected second overall in the 1991 NBA Draft by the New Jersey Nets. Played for several NBA teams, including the Boston Celtics and the Portland Trail Blazers. Achieved NBA All-Star recognition in 1994. Transitioned to coaching after retirement, holding positions at various colleges and programs.

Matthew Pinsent

British Olympic rowing champion and sportscaster
Born
October 10th, 1970 54 years ago

Achieved significant success in rowing, winning four Olympic gold medals across four consecutive Games from 1992 to 2004. Specialized in coxless pairs and coxless fours, representing Great Britain. Transitioned into broadcasting and became a sports commentator and presenter for various media outlets. Undertook challenges such as climbing Mount Kilimanjaro to raise funds for charity endeavors.

Silke Kraushaar-Pielach

German sled racer and Olympic champion
Born
October 10th, 1970 54 years ago

Competed in luge, achieving significant successes in international competitions. Secured a gold medal in the women's singles event at the 1998 Winter Olympics in Nagano. Won multiple gold medals at the World Championships, demonstrating consistent top performance throughout the career. Participated in the FIL World Luge Championships, earning further accolades.

Dean Kiely

Footballer and goalkeeper for West Brom
Born
October 10th, 1970 54 years ago

Played professional football primarily as a goalkeeper. Career spanned several clubs including West Bromwich Albion, where tenure lasted from 2004 to 2007. Also played for other teams like Manchester City, Bury, and Gillingham. Represented the Republic of Ireland at the international level, earning caps in various competitions during the 1990s and 2000s. Retired from professional football in 2008.

MC Lyte

American rapper and actress
Born
October 11th, 1970 54 years ago

Active since the late 1980s, this artist emerged as a pioneering female rapper in hip-hop. The debut album, 'Lyte as a Rock,' released in 1988, provided a platform that showcased lyrical prowess and strong messages. Apart from music, ventured into acting roles, featuring in projects such as 'Doin' It in the Park: Pick-Up Basketball in New York City.' Significant contributions to hip-hop culture and advocacy for women in the music industry marked this career.
